A review by aruejohns
Raven Stole the Moon by Garth Stein

4.0

Raven Stole the Moon is set in the Tlingit religion, and is the journey of a woman to save her son's soul. One of the themes throughout the book is the difference between belief and knowledge. My favorite quote from the book is " Belief is an option, and this isn't an option for me. It's real. I don't believe any of it. I know it." I would definitely recommend this book.
